{"id":15047,"date":"2022-05-20T07:27:04","date_gmt":"2022-05-20T14:27:04","guid":{"rendered":"https:\/\/gregalder.com\/yardposts\/?p=15047"},"modified":"2022-05-20T07:27:07","modified_gmt":"2022-05-20T14:27:07","slug":"how-avocado-trees-flower","status":"publish","type":"post","link":"https:\/\/gregalder.com\/yardposts\/how-avocado-trees-flower\/","title":{"rendered":"How avocado trees flower"},"content":{"rendered":"\n<p>Bloom season is the most exciting for me when it comes to avocados. First, I look at the buds on the branches of trees to try to predict how many will become flowers. Then I observe the bees and flies visiting the flowers. Are there enough? Are the flowers getting pollinated? Finally, I search for green BBs, the sign that fruit has set and that next year will have a harvest. There&#8217;s so much hope.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Do you also enjoy this process? Is it new for you? Read only the introduction of this paper for a summary of the seminal discoveries and discussions about avocado flowering over the last century: <a href=\"http:\/\/www.avocadosource.com\/Journals\/SAAGA\/SAAGA_2016\/SAAGA_2016_39_PG_070.pdf\">&#8220;Finding the best polliniser for \u2018Hass\u2019 avocado and the effect of honeybees as pollinators&#8221;<\/a> by Bezuidenhout, du Toit, Robbertse, et al.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>4. Nirody was the first to write about avocado varieties having male or female flowers at different times, and he suggested pairing trees for pollination, all in his Master&#8217;s degree thesis written exactly one hundred years ago: <a href=\"http:\/\/www.avocadosource.com\/CAS_Yearbooks\/CAS_07_1921\/CAS_1921-22_PG_65-78.pdf\">&#8220;Investigations in Avocado Breeding.&#8221;<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>5. Stout was the first to classify avocado varieties as &#8220;A&#8221; or &#8220;B&#8221; according to their flowering behavior in his paper, <a href=\"http:\/\/www.avocadosource.com\/CAS_Yearbooks\/CAS_08_1922\/CAS_1922-23_PG_29-45.pdf\">&#8220;A Study in Cross-Pollination of Avocados in Southern California.&#8221;<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<div style=\"height:100px\" aria-hidden=\"true\" class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Video presentations on avocado flowering<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><a href=\"http:\/\/indexfresh.com\/seminar\/pollination-seminar\/\">Here you can view two comprehensive presentations<\/a> by Mary Lu Arpaia, of the University of California, and Reuben Hofshi, creator of Avocadosource, about avocado flowering and pollination.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<div style=\"height:100px\" aria-hidden=\"true\" class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Yard Posts related to avocado flowering<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>You might like to check out these other posts I&#8217;ve written that are related to avocado flowering and the fruit set and fruit drop stages just after flowering: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/gregalder.com\/yardposts\/what-are-the-best-avocado-pollination-conditions\/\">&#8220;What are the best avocado pollination conditions?&#8221;<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/gregalder.com\/yardposts\/mobile-avocado-pollenizer-tree\/\">&#8220;Mobile avocado pollenizer tree&#8221;<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/gregalder.com\/yardposts\/should-you-remove-avocados-from-a-small-tree\/\">&#8220;Should you remove avocados from a small tree?&#8221;<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/gregalder.com\/yardposts\/avocado-fruit-drop-why-when-how-many\/\">&#8220;Avocado fruit drop: Why?
